From the alternatives given, select the word closest in meaning to the underlined word. They are carrying out a charade of negotiations with the government.

1)series
2)charter
3)absurd pretence✓ Correct
4)spate

A 'charade' in this context means an absurd pretence or a false show intended to create a pleasant or respectable appearance, making option 3 the correct choice.
